Section 23XO — Crimes Act 1914: Person may get help to carry out forensic procedures
Text of the provision Official document
(1) A person who is authorised to carry out a forensic procedure under the table in section 23XM is authorised to ask another person to help him or her to carry out the procedure, and the other person is authorised to give that help. (2) A person who is asked to help carry out a forensic procedure need not be a person mentioned in the table in section 23XM. (3) A person who is asked to help carry out a forensic procedure may use reasonable force to enable the forensic procedure to be carried out.
